The counselling centres for students at a glance

Students can turn to lecturers at any time with their questions and problems - however, they are not the only points of contact.

JMU offers a wide range of specialized counselling centres that students can access free of charge. For issues of a social, legal or psychological nature, students can therefore also contact other institutions with counselling services or lecturers may refer them to these institutions:
